Somehow I missed it in my first read of the specs, it does have HDMI CEC according to the specs:
“HDMI - HDMI 2.1 with CEC support” Framework | Order a Framework Desktop with AMD Ryzen™ AI Max 300

I want to turn my TV on and off from my HTPC, that’s all. I bind a keyboard key to turn on the TV, one to turn off the TV, then I only need my keyboard to control my entire AV system.
Currently I have a rather custom solution with an STM32H7 dev board gaffer taped onto the back of my TV to wiggle the HDMI CEC pin. I intended to make it into a real board with a proper HDMI connector, but part shortages for the STM32H7 (the only MCU that I know of with Ethernet + HDMI CEC) delayed the project.
